Welcome to Realivent, a new website integrating a number of applications in the real estate arena.  I’m more impressed with the concept than the current execution, but it’s got potential.

Nubricks bagged an interview with Kendra Todd, winner of Donald Trump’s Apprentice 3.  Just goes to show that the real estate blog community is gaining in power.

Sellsius released a new plugin for the wordpress community that encourages random surfing of a blog’s archives.

Dustin from Rain City Guide will be blogging from NARdi Gras.  He also has some great advice for new real estate bloggers.  I especially like the advice that links will come with time and when you least expect it.

Real Estate Blogsites has released a press release that it will unveil Innovative Structured Blogging for Real Estate at Nardi Gras.  I don’t know what it is but I think they need a new name for it.

House4Cell is now allowing home shoppers to get property information via text messages while they are at a property.
